Intervention access

In distress situations, machines may need to be controlled or default escape actions may need to be initiated from a distance. Distressed speech is extremely difficult to understand and there hasn't been much research in this area. We call these speech-based escape systems intervention access systems, and are looking at these kinds of speech more closely.

 

Speech and gesture

Multimodal speech recognition has gained much attention in recent years. Multimodal applications understand human speech by analyzing other cues parallely with speech, such as lip movements and facial expressions. This improves understanding and response performance greatly under many conditions, but is computationally very expensive for small devices. At Haikya we are developing technologies for low-cost, high-performance speech and gesture analysis systems.
